T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to a crossbeam structure applied to a portal bed body. BACKGROUND

[0002] At present, with the continuous improvement of the power of the laser, the cuttable material thickness of the laser cutting machine also increases, so that it more and more pursues large-scale processing, which brings new challenges to the crossbeam structure, and the crossbeam structure has to develop in the direction of lightweight, long span, high rigidity, etc. The laser cutting machine with small amplitude usually adopts cast aluminum structure and profile extrusion structure, etc. When the amplitude increases, the rigidity of the material itself will decrease obviously.

[0003] The laser cutting machine with large amplitude usually adopts carbon steel plate welding structure. Although the selection of carbon steel welding can increase the rigidity of the crossbeam, the weight will also increase obviously, so a larger driving motor power is needed. In view of the above technical problems, the crossbeam structure applied to the portal bed body designed by the patent adopts carbon steel plate welding, reduces the overall weight in structure, and considers rigidity and long span at the same time. SUMMARY

[0004] The utility model discloses a crossbeam structure applied to a portal bed body.

[0005] A crossbeam structure applied to a portal bed body, including the crossbeam main part, the crossbeam main part is hollow structure, and multiple interval parallel support plates are arranged in the inside, the support plate is " back " shape structure, the crossbeam main part includes upper side plate, lower side plate, left side plate, right side plate, front component, rear component, the front component and rear component all include multiple rectangular tubes, and multiple rectangular tubes are stacked, the upper side plate and lower side plate are connected with the upper and lower of front component and rear component respectively, and the left side plate and right side plate are connected with the left and right of front component and rear component respectively.

[0006] Further, the upper side plate and the lower side plate are both made of carbon steel.

[0007] Further, the upper side plate, the lower side plate, the left side plate, the right side plate, the front component and the rear component are fixedly connected by welding.

[0008] Further, the support plate is connected in the crossbeam main part by welding.

[0009] Further, the crossbeam main part is provided with a motor seat on both sides in front.

[0010] Further, the left side plate and the right side plate are both provided with through holes.

[0011] Beneficial effects: compared with the prior art, the whole adopts carbon steel plate welding structure, replaces the cast aluminum beam structure of small amplitude laser cutting machine, ensures the overall rigidity of the beam in the application process of long span laser cutting machine, internally welds multiple groups of supporting plates, and the supporting plates are in a back-shaped structure, thereby reducing the overall weight of the beam, improving the bending resistance of the beam, and realizing the long span application of the beam.
